Candlelight is a charming 55+ age-restricted mobile home park community located in Orange City, Florida. This established neighborhood provides a peaceful, affordable living environment tailored specifically for seniors seeking a relaxed lifestyle in Volusia County. With its roots dating back to the 1970s, the community features paved streets and a mix of single and multi-section homes on approximately 108 sites.
The community was developed around 1970 as a mobile home park and has maintained its focus as a senior living destination. The associated homeowners association was formally incorporated in 1988, though current records indicate it is inactive.
Situated at 2000 N Volusia Ave in Orange City, FL 32763, Candlelight benefits from convenient access to major roadways including US-17 and proximity to Interstate 4. Residents enjoy easy travel to nearby cities like Deltona, DeBary, and Daytona Beach.
Life in Candlelight revolves around a senior-friendly atmosphere with planned social activities that foster connections among residents. The age-restricted policy ensures a quiet, community-oriented setting ideal for retirees.
Properties consist primarily of mobile and manufactured homes available for purchase or rental. Median listing prices in the broader area hover around $344,000, though specific Candlelight listings often emphasize affordability and lot ownership or rental options.
Orange City offers historic charm with access to the St. Johns River and natural springs. Residents are close to Blue Spring State Park for manatee viewing and outdoor recreation.
While on-site facilities are limited, the surrounding Volusia County area provides ample opportunities for parks, trails, and water activities.
Local conveniences include nearby grocery stores, pharmacies, and dining options along Volusia Avenue and in central Orange City. Larger retail centers are accessible in Deltona and Daytona Beach.
The community is served by Volusia County public transit options, with easy driving access to regional highways for commuting or travel.
